Transaction 526a4d755ca628673cbf0f13354035c69e7c406917b1ca1ed9d2b0aedb67fa24

1 Input
2 Outputs
  • 526a4d755ca628673cbf0f13354035c69e7c406917b1ca1ed9d2b0aedb67fa24:0
  • value  221090541198
    address  2MvffhKuyjzbBo4wjnUhTvSx84yPs9Ko75z
  • 526a4d755ca628673cbf0f13354035c69e7c406917b1ca1ed9d2b0aedb67fa24:1
  • value  44228000
    address  mkEWchXX1mR53uhE2SVj7AkgBNorBFjnr6